Abstract
Planning for a U.S. test blanket module to operate in the internationally-sponsored ITER
reactor has focused attention on the many coating and compatibility issues that will need to be
solved before fusion energy moves from concept to commercial reality. Examples are given for (1)
a dual-layer, electrically-resistant coating as a potential solution to reduce the
magnetohydrodynamic pressure drop with liquid Li and (2) materials compatibility issues with
eutectic Pb-Li for conventional alloys and SiC/SiC composites. Because of the reduced activity of
Li in Pb-Li, a wider range of functional materials can be considered in this system. Nevertheless, an
Al2O3 scale on FeCrAl was transformed to LiAlO2
after exposure to Pb-Li at 800°C.
